General Information
After school clubs are open to currently enrolled CMES students only. They meet one hour a week (2:40-3:40) on a Monday or a Thursday. All questions and concerns about a club should be directed to the club representative. The PTO is only the facilitator for getting the clubs into the school. Registration, scheduling, payment, cancellations, etc. are all between you and the club.
Clubs are open to currently enrolled CMES students.
Clubs do not meet if there is no school or an early dismissal, but check with the club specifically.
Parents are not responsible for getting their child from class to the clubs. The school and/or club handles that.
The clubs are: Abrakadoodle, Lyte Run, LEGO Robotics, and Chess Academy
Pickup Procedures -- PLEASE READ CAREFULLY
After School Care: Once the club ends, SACC kids will be returned to SACC for normal pickup procedures.
Walkers and Bus Riders: You will need to pick up your child from school; children cannot leave by themselves.
Parents are responsible for informing the school that their walker or bus-rider will be picked up on club days.
It is also important that you tell the club who will be picking up your child. There will not be anybody in the main office when the clubs let out. There will be a teacher on site helping with dismissal, but the clubs need to know who is authorized to pick up the kids.
Sample email, with relevant information: Dear [TEACHER NAME]. [CHILD NAME] will be going to [CLUB NAME] every [DAY OF THE WEEK] from [START DATE] to [END DATE]. On those days, my child will not be [RIDING THE BUS / WALKING HOME]. Instead, they will be picked up by [NAME OF PERSON].
